Centre's 'Make in India' in trouble as auto industry faces possibility of production stoppages forced by tough import rules

India's steel ministry is pressurising automakers to use locally made steel, endangering 'Make in India' by refusing to back down on tougher import rules despite warnings that the new regulations could disrupt the production of cars, government and industry sources said.
